Job Description

The Crypto Engineering team is responsible for data protection for on premise, mobile and in the Cloud. We are tasked with the proposal, design, build, automation, implementation and L3 support of Data Protection technologies and, as needed, the re-engineering of existing technologies in the Security space. This will entail completion of low level design, build, and preparation/documentation for hand over to operational support teams.

The candidate must possess subject matter expertise on encryption and security for public cloud.

This role will be responsible for solutions in areas such as, but not limited to:

  • Protecting data in Public Cloud (Azure, AWS)

  • Vormetric/CipherTrust Data At Rest Encryption

  • Hardware Security Module (HSM) – Thales, Entrust, Utimaco Attala

  • SME in at least 1 or more of the following Cryptographic tools (Vormetric, Symantec Encryption Manager, Venafi), PKI (Microsoft CA, Self-signed CA, Verisign/Symantec)

  • Key Management

The successful candidate must have demonstrated ability to engineer, design, build, support and document solutions in these areas of Crypto Engineering working closely with Business and the wider Engineering teams to ensure built solutions enhance productivity and add business value.

Technical Requirements

It is expected that the Engineer II will have sound technical knowledge in a wide range of Security technologies, frameworks, tools, processes and procedures. This role is looking for people with skills in as many of the below technology areas as possible:

  • Expertise in either: Unix/Linux, Databases or Storage (SAN, NAS)

  • In-depth knowledge of various cryptographic and encryption technologies and standards (Symmetric/Asymmetric cryptography, Public Key cryptography, Digital signing service, Message Digest and Certificate Authority).

  • Detailed understanding of firewalls, intrusion detection systems, authentication mechanisms, and networking protocols including SMTP, HTTP, DNS, TCP/IP, and SNMP as they pertain to security solutions.

  • Experience with Security as it applies to Cloud Solutions in Highly Virtualized Environments.

  • Experience in scripting in at least one language (PowerShell, Python, etc.)
